Included in Smithsonian Magazine as one of 10 “unexpected places to see the Berlin Wall,” Main Street Station houses a portion of the famed wall inside a men’s restroom off the casino floor where glass partitions protect the wall from three urinals.
Visitors to the Nevada Northern Railway Museum get to join a trip back in time to the age when the iron horse ruled the rails. The in-operation historical railroad offers 90-minute trips through tunnels and up real mountain grades.
